Record and Growth:
On-line poker emerged into the belated 1990s because of breakthroughs in technology in addition to internet. The very first on-line poker room, globe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. But was at early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ential development,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Recognition and Accessibility:
One of the main good reasons for the enormous popularity of online poker is its availability. People can log on to their most favorite internet poker platforms anytime, from anywhere, utilizing their computer systems or mobile devices. This convenience has drawn a diverse player base, which range from recreational people to specialists, contributing to the quick growth of on-line poker.

Advantages of Internet Poker:
Internet poker provides a number of benefits over traditional br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it provides a broader array of online game choices, including various poker alternatives and stakes, providing towards preferences and spending plans of all of the forms of players. Also, on-line poker rooms tend to be open 24/7, eliminating the constraints of actual casino running hours. Moreover, on line platforms frequently offer appealing bonuses, loyalty programs, in addition to power to play multiple tables simultaneously, improving the entire gaming experience.
